We are asked to find for which values of x is the rational expression:

\dfrac{x+5}{3x^2-3} is undefined.

We know that a rational expression is undefined when the denominator term is equal to zero.

Hence, we could represent the algebraic expression as:

\dfrac{x+5}{3x^2-3}=\dfrac{x+5}{3(x^2-1)}\\\\\dfrac{x+5}{3x^2-3}=\dfrac{x+5}{3(x-1)(x+1)}

Hence, clearly from the expression we could observe that:

the expression is not defined when x=1 or x=-1.

( since the denominator will be zero if x receives any of the above two values or both)

Hence, the values of x for which the expression is not defined is equal to 1 or -1.
